On average across the year,
yes, Bosnia and Herzegovina is hotter than
Grand Rapids, Michigan
.
Bosnia and Herzegovina has an average temperature of 13°C/55°F and Grand Rapids, Michigan has an average temperature of 10°C/50°F.
Bosnia and Herzegovina's hottest month is August, with an average maximum temperature of 31°C/88°F, which is hotter than Grand Rapids, Michigan's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 29°C/84°F).
On average across the year, no, Bosnia and Herzegovina is not colder than Grand Rapids, Michigan . Bosnia and Herzegovina has an average minimum temperature of 7°C/45°F and Grand Rapids, Michigan has an average minimum temperature of 5°C/41°F.
On average across the year,
no, Bosnia and Herzegovina has less rain than
Grand Rapids, Michigan. Bosnia and Herzegovina has an average annual rainfall of 534mm and Grand Rapids, Michigan has an average annual rainfall of 1140mm.
Bosnia and Herzegovina's wettest month is May, with an average monthly rainfall of 74mm, which is drier than Grand Rapids, Michigan's wettest month (October, with an average monthly rainfall of 139mm).
